A Saas-based Startup, EnableX Puts High Bet on Telecommunication Sector to Boost Growth

EnableX is expecting to make revenues of $3 to $5 million in FY 2024, after having already grown 50% YoY in the last two years, as per a top executive of the SaaS based startup. This growth is accelerated by newly introduced CPaaS business majorly generating from Indian telecom operators.

Pankaj Gupta, Founder and CEO, EnableX, said, “Approximately 50% of the revenue will originate from sources outside of India. In the next three years, we anticipate growing to be the largest CPaaS (Communications Platform-as-a-Service) partner for telcos.”

EnableX, currently has written agreements with over 10 telecom carriers to whom it provides communication functionalities including video API, voice API, and others. It is further planning to grow its partnership with over 50 telecom carriers.

The SaaS startup has received less than $1 million from overseas investors in pre-seed funding and is going to raise more funds in future, if required. As per the chief executive, a major Indian telecom company has merged this bootstrapped business capacity to provide video as a medium by its own communication suite.

EnableX has its headquarters in Singapore. The business is planning to expand in Middle East region in Quarter 1, FY24 in order to cater to its East European customers. Gupta even indicated in a statement that they will cover market of United States by the year end!
